
The fact that Chrome for Chrome OS, Windows, Mac, and Linux allows you to remotely connect to a PC with the same browser has long been known. After the appearance of this function, many users of the browser began to work with it. Now, Chrome developers plan to release an application for mobile devices, allowing you to connect to a computer with a working Chrome browser.
That is, from a tablet or phone, you can easily go to your work / home PC and work with equipment remotely. The application has already received the name Chromoting. One of the first to
write about the application was
François Beaufort , a Google evangelist. This is not the first such application for Android, but it may well be that the “native” program will be more functional than Splashtop, LogMeIn, or TeamViewer.

The developers promise that to connect to a remote PC or laptop from a mobile device will need to make a minimum of gestures. It may be that feedback will also be provided when the user can “steer” from a PC with his smartphone or tablet. I would like to hope so.
By the way, the work on Chromoting has just begun, this week the developers have begun the implementation of their plan for the first time. Well, we are waiting for the finished program, I would hope that the development process will not be delayed for a long time.
